3D Printing in Dental Surgery



To enhance the area of oral surgery, you can explore the subtopic of 3D printing in oral surgery. This ingenious modern technology has the potential to change the way dental cosmetic surgeons run and deal with patients. Here are 4 crucial ways in which 3D printing is forming the area:

- ** Personalized Surgical Guides **: 3D printing permits the development of extremely accurate and patient-specific medical overviews, enhancing the precision and efficiency of treatments.

- ** Implant Prosthetics **: With 3D printing, dental doctors can create personalized dental implant prosthetics that perfectly fit a patient's unique makeup, resulting in far better results and client contentment.

- ** Bone Grafting **: 3D printing allows the manufacturing of patient-specific bone grafts, lowering the demand for conventional implanting methods and enhancing recovery and healing time.

- ** Education and learning and Educating **: 3D printing can be used to produce sensible surgical designs for academic objectives, enabling oral specialists to exercise complicated procedures prior to doing them on patients.

With its potential to enhance precision, personalization, and training, 3D printing is an interesting development in the field of dental surgery.
